Signal Blockers Cut Prison Calls by 99%, Conatel Says

Published on Honduras Daily · Aug 16, 2026 · Originally reported August 14, 2026 by El Heraldo

Honduras's telecommunications authority says Israeli-made signal-blocking technology installed at 21 prisons has cut outgoing calls by 99%, though inmates keep getting around the restrictions by smuggling in mobile devices and using Wi-Fi messaging apps.
